Knocking a nail into a wooden block with a hammer involves conversion between different forms of energy. Which of the following options present the correct order for this conversion?
A
Chemical energy `rarr` (Sound energy+heat energy) `rarr` kinetic energy
B
Chemical energy `rarr` kinetic energy `rarr` (sound energy + heat energy)
C
Chemical energy `rarr` kinetic energy-heat energy
D
(Sound energy + heat energy) `rarr` kinetic energy `rarr` chemical energy

To solve the question regarding the conversion of energy when knocking a nail into a wooden block with a hammer, we can break down the process into clear steps:
### Step-by-Step Solution:
1. **Identify the Initial Energy**:
When you hold the hammer, it has potential energy due to its position. However, in the context of the question, we can consider the energy involved when you strike the nail.
2. **Hammer Striking the Nail**:
When you swing the hammer and hit the nail, the potential energy of the hammer is converted into kinetic energy. This is the energy of motion that the hammer has as it moves towards the nail.
3. **Nail Penetrating the Wood**:
As the hammer strikes the nail, the kinetic energy from the hammer is transferred to the nail. This causes the nail to move and penetrate into the wooden block. Thus, the kinetic energy of the hammer is converted into kinetic energy of the nail.
4. **Heat Generation**:
As the nail penetrates the wood, friction occurs between the nail and the wood. This friction converts some of the kinetic energy into thermal energy (heat). The nail may become hot due to this heat generation.
5. **Sound Production**:
Additionally, when the hammer strikes the nail, sound energy is produced. This sound is a result of the impact and the vibrations created during the process.
6. **Final Energy Forms**:
Therefore, the energy conversions can be summarized as:
- **Chemical Energy (from the muscles) → Kinetic Energy (of the hammer) → Kinetic Energy (of the nail) → Heat Energy + Sound Energy**.
### Conclusion:
The correct order of energy conversion when knocking a nail into a wooden block with a hammer is:
- **Chemical Energy → Kinetic Energy → Heat Energy + Sound Energy**.
